The Three Sisters, a group of islands in Canada, are nestled within the scenic Thousand Islands region along the Canada-US border. These islands are positioned at a latitude of 44° 35′ 45″ N and a longitude of 76° 07′ 31″ W, within the coordinate box of 44°36′ x 76°06′. This cluster includes the Isles of the Gremlins and Northstar, adding to the allure of this captivating archipelago.

Located within the municipality of Leeds and Thousand Islands, in the county of Leeds and Grenville, Ontario, the Three Sisters are part of a region renowned for its picturesque landscapes and rich natural beauty.
